LAS VEGAS — Four Utah Utes and two BYU Cougars made the Mountain West Conference's All-Preseason team, which was released Tuesday morning at the league's football media day at the Red Rock Resort.
Utah is represented by running back Eddie Wide, offensive lineman Caleb Schlauderaff, center Zane Taylor and defensive back Brandon Burton. BYU placed offensive lineman Matt Reynolds and safety Andrew Rich on the squad.
TCU dominated the preseason team. Quarterback Andy Dalton, linebacker Tank Carder and return specialist Jeremy Kerley were tabbed as offensive, defensive and special teams players of the year, respectively.
